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0432478160 6413522 50502201 3288
01967 79397
01967 79397
93 61760823 887 0846 145
All about undefined
Interested in learning more?
01967 79397
93 61760823 887 0846 145
See more
68946980106 5084718196 366964466
14869 01016634060 3813881 18378708 56597
See more
89925501 83
06 365636032 54
See more